The medical device market landscape and rising demand for contract manufacturing
Worldwide demand for medtech is rising rapidly. Analysts see $595+B+ by 2024 and $625+B by 2027, with ~6% annual growth through 2030.
Growth drives demand for scalable production, broader portfolios, and stringent quality from partners offering leading medical device manufacturing services.
Advances in heart, bone, neuro, urinary, and diabetes technologies are fueling new products. These areas need high-precision parts, electronics, and sterilizable components. To get these, many producers of medical devices are choosing to outsource.
They do this to use specific tooling, automated processes, and inspection systems without heavy CapEx.
By outsourcing, companies can get their products out faster. Contract manufacturers have the facilities, clean rooms, and know-how that compress time from design to finished product. Partnerships are vital for remote-control and connected health devices to scale effectively.

Telehealth Ventilator & Remote Control Innovations
As a Tier-2 supplier, AMT played a vital role in the first telehealth ventilator supporting manual and remote control—cutting PPE use and allowing one clinician to monitor many patients from a single station—showcasing expertise in connected-care devices.
Assisted cough machines and respiratory therapy device examples
AMT built systems for high-frequency chest vibrations, lung expansion, and cough assistance, maintaining airway patency with Positive Airway Pressure during breaks and using clean air-path control—requiring exact PCBA, precise molded fluid paths, and clean packaging—demonstrating leadership in respiratory devices.
Single-use surgical components such as TURP electrodes
AMT produces single-use TURP electrodes in stainless steel or tungsten, delivered sterile—demanding material control, traceability, and sterile packaging—highlighting proficiency in disposable surgical manufacturing.

How to Choose a Contract Manufacturer in Singapore
Selecting a good manufacturer is critical to product quality, regulatory success, and speed to market; Singapore offers global shipping, skilled talent, and strong compliance—compare carefully to preserve project value when choosing AMT or others.
Certifications & Track Record
Verify ISO 13485/9001 and 21 CFR 820; assess QMS docs (CAPA, DHR); seek evidence in respiratory, telehealth, and disposables.
Facilities & Logistics
Audit cleanrooms, tooling/molding, PCBA, automation; onsite checks confirm capacity and monitoring; Singapore’s hub speeds global logistics.
Communication, IP protection and partnership models
Ensure secure project management and design handling; protect IP with controlled access and qualified suppliers; evaluate engineering support and supply continuity; confirm ability to scale across target markets.
Area | What to check | Why it matters |
---|---|---|
Regulatory Compliance | ISO 13485, ISO 9001, 21 CFR Part 820, FDA-aligned QMS | Ensures market entry readiness and lowers regulatory risk |
Technical | Cleanrooms, molding, PCBA, automation, tooling | Supports reproducible quality and scalable manufacturing |
Experience | Case studies in respiratory, telehealth, surgical disposables | Faster onboarding, better first-run yield |
Logistics & Location | Ports proximity, regional channels, lead time | Cuts delays and inventory costs |
Commercial/Legal | NDA/IP, flexible contracts, pricing | Asset protection with scalable terms |
Communication/Culture | PM tools, reporting cadence, on-site audits | Improves transparency and long-term collaboration |
Ask for customer feedback and conduct site visits to validate claims; pilot a small batch to assess process and supply fit—proper diligence builds confidence in a long-term partnership with AMT or another top medical device firm.
